Right now, we’ll tell you about the latest improvements of the current OGS Mahjong.First of all, we’ve fixed most of the known problems with running OGS Mahjong under Linux.Also, the game will receive a Hindi translation (thanks to Abhijeet Pokhriyal).The main feature of the new version is online rating. Now, OGS Mahjong player will be able not only to store his results locally, but also share them with the world. You can try it already. The statistics server is up and running and we inviting you to test it.
In order to do it, you’ll need to take two steps.
First, register on the statistics website.
Second, download the unstable verstion of the game with the online rating support:

After installing and launching the game, open the settings menu, go to the “Game” tab and enable the online mode, then enter your username and password. After that, the game uploads you results to the statistics server each time you play. You can view it on the website and inside the game.
If you don’t want to use online rating, simply disable the online mode and the game will continue to keep your results locally, as it was before.
